Understanding Florida's Dynamic Climate
What makes Florida's weather so special and, let's be honest, sometimes a little wild? It's all about its unique geography, guys. Surrounded by water on three sides β the Atlantic Ocean to the east, the Gulf of Mexico to the west, and the Straits of Florida to the south β the state is heavily influenced by marine air masses. This means humidity is a constant companion, often leading to those classic afternoon thunderstorms, especially during the summer months. We're talking about a tropical and subtropical climate that's responsible for those postcard-perfect sunny days, but also for the occasional dramatic weather event. The flat terrain of Florida also plays a role; there are no major mountain ranges to disrupt weather patterns, allowing systems to move across the state with relative ease. The Influence of Hurricanes and Tropical Storms
When we talk about Florida weather, we absolutely cannot ignore the elephant in the room: hurricanes and tropical storms. These powerful systems are a significant part of Florida's weather narrative, especially from June 1st to November 30th, the official hurricane season. The Atlantic hurricane season is a period that demands attention and preparedness from residents and visitors alike. Florida's long coastline and its position in the path of many developing tropical systems make it particularly vulnerable. We've all seen the news, the evacuations, the storm preparations β it's a reality of living in paradise. Understanding the formation, tracking, and potential impact of these storms is crucial. This includes knowing the difference between a tropical depression, a tropical storm, and a hurricane, and understanding the Saffir-Simpson Hurricane Wind Scale. Staying informed through reliable Florida USA weather news sources is paramount during this season. It's not just about the wind and rain; it's about the storm surge, the heavy rainfall leading to inland flooding, and the devastating potential for tornadoes that can be spawned by these systems. Tips for Staying Prepared and Safe
Living in or visiting Florida means embracing its unique weather, and preparedness is the name of the game. We're not just talking about hurricane season, although that's a major part of it. This also includes being ready for those intense summer thunderstorms, heat advisories, and even the occasional cold snap that can surprise Floridians in the winter. Having an emergency kit is always a good idea, stocked with essentials like water, non-perishable food, a first-aid kit, flashlights, and batteries. For hurricane season, this means having a plan: know your evacuation zone, have a communication plan with your family, and secure your home as much as possible. Florida USA weather news plays a vital role in this preparedness. Reliable alerts and warnings can give you the crucial lead time needed to take action. Beyond major events, simple daily preparedness can make a huge difference. For instance, staying hydrated during hot summer days, wearing sunscreen, and knowing the signs of heat exhaustion are essential. Understanding UV index reports and seeking shade during peak sun hours can prevent nasty sunburns. We'll also cover tips for driving safely during heavy rain or fog, and how to protect your pets during extreme weather. Staying Ahead of the Storm: Resources for Hurricane Season
Hurricane season is a serious time for Florida, and having the right resources at your fingertips is non-negotiable. When those swirling masses start forming in the Atlantic or Gulf, you need to know where to get the most accurate and up-to-the-minute Florida USA weather news. The National Hurricane Center (NHC) is your primary go-to for all things tropical. Their website and advisories provide detailed information on storm tracks, intensity forecasts, and potential impacts, including storm surge and rainfall predictions. They are the gold standard for tropical weather information. Beyond the NHC, your local National Weather Service (NWS) forecast office is another critical resource. They issue local warnings and advisories specific to your area and often provide more localized interpretations of the larger storm systems. Many Florida counties also have their own emergency management agencies that provide crucial information on evacuations, shelter openings, and local preparedness guidelines. Don't underestimate the power of reputable local news outlets, either; they often have dedicated meteorologists who break down complex weather information into easily understandable terms and provide on-the-ground reporting. Embracing Florida's Climate: Opportunities and Challenges
Florida's climate presents a unique set of opportunities and challenges, shaping everything from its tourism industry to its agricultural output. The year-round warmth and sunshine are undeniable draws, attracting millions of visitors and residents who cherish the outdoor lifestyle. This also fuels a robust tourism sector, dependent on pleasant weather for beachgoers, theme park enthusiasts, and outdoor adventurers. However, this idyllic climate comes with its own set of hurdles. The high humidity and frequent rainfall, while supporting lush vegetation, can also create challenges like mold growth and pest issues. Furthermore, the intense heat during summer months requires constant awareness and preventative measures against heatstroke and dehydration, especially for outdoor workers and those engaging in strenuous activities. The economic impact of weather is also significant; a successful tourist season can hinge on favorable conditions, while a severe hurricane can cause billions in damages and disrupt supply chains for months.
